There are no trombones in this piece. Only brass are two trumpets and I think two horns. Trombones were never in symphonies until Joachim Nicolas Eggert wrote his third symphony in 1807. Then Beethoven started using them, too in his 5th and 9th symphonies. There is no "umph" in this movement really..it's the second movement of a symphony, typically the slow movement. There's that fortissimo surprise, and some later minor variations of the melody played forte, but that's it.
